A Few Principles to Ponder Multimedia Principle People learn better from words and pictures than from words alone. Contiguity Principle People learn better when corresponding words and pictures are presented at the same time or next to each other on the screen. Coherence Principle People learn better when extraneous material is excluded rather than included. Signaling Principle People learn more deeply when cues are added that highlight the main ideas and organization of the words.
